Ticket: https://dfedigital.atlassian.net/browse/AQTS-1191
This PR introduces a simple page available within CMS for staff members who have staff management access to show the number of applications relevant to our service level agreements (SLA's) when it comes to prioritisation.
This new page gives an overview of the number of applications nearing and breaching the SLA's (10 and 40 day SLA's) as well as a list of all application forms relevant:
10 day SLA relates to application forms that are going through prioritisation checks and expect checks to begin within 10 days of being submitted. For these applications, we consider them as nearing SLA once they are within 2 days of breaching the SLA.
40 day SLA relates to application forms are prioritised and expect initial assessment to be completed and moved to verification within 40 days of being submitted. For these applications, we consider them as nearing SLA once they are within 5 days of breaching the SLA.
